Inspection Services is a core part of the Manheim Inventory Solutions business and is the number one provider of end of lease vehicle inspection and logistics services. Inspection Services offers its customers a seamless process that enables them to capture end of lease damage on the vehicle in the presence of the Hirer, thus providing a tangible return on investment. Inspection Services delivers volumes into our Vehicle Services and Auctions business as well as vehicles to businesses outside the Manheim portfolio. By servicing our Customers, Inspection Services are a trusted business partner of many large manufacturer and leasing companies.

Scope of Role: Reporting to the Transport & Planning Manager, you will be responsible for the day-to-day running of the Transport department and management of the team members within it. The Manheim Inspections Transport Division successfully coordinates the timely movement of 140,000+ vehicles per annum, from hub sites to sale locations, between auction locations and dealer deliveries, utilising Manheim Logistics, internal resources, and multiple third-party logistics providers.

Key Responsibilities: Manage the Transport Team Members in line with Cox Automotive guidelines, ensuring regular 1-2-1’s and check-ins are completed. Efficient and effective management of the Transport Team, including: Booking of vehicle movements within agreed customer SLA’s. Reporting on WIP (Work in Progress movements). Supporting the team with managing bespoke customer processes such as Key 4 Key movements & implementation of new accounts/processes. Ensure all systems are accurately updated with POC/POD information. Maintain high standards in customer communications, both internal and external, completed within SLA. Monitor costs to move vs income received and present to the Transport and Planning Manager. Plan EV movements to ensure cost-effective routes are taken when allocating a vehicle to either a subcontractor or in-house resource, considering miles travelled, current charge, vehicle range, hubs, and the requirement to charge on route.
